I try to let my cameras out for 3 weeks at a time and only check them when I think the batteries or the memory card are about out of juice or room or I just can't wait any more. I spray down and wear rubber MUCK boots when I go into the area I plan to hunt. I think the #1 thing guys do wrong is not being patient and always wanting to check out their spot. You'll have plenty of time to see whats going on there when the season opens until then let the cameras do their job by watching your area 24/7 .
